Output 50a95f996ec139bc06a0e5365f4ca5dadf1852c0a90101ec853207838e16031f:0

value
98613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cacaa5145d9d29bd3f3285a038f9ea935590bff OP_EQUAL
address
3MoqRjzKbDE3BwhnZkuLSZ9uj772457Y5C
transaction
50a95f996ec139bc06a0e5365f4ca5dadf1852c0a90101ec853207838e16031f
spent
true